BEIJING : Reigning champions United States knocked off world number one side Britain in the men's curling at the National Aquatics Centre on Friday while favourites Sweden stormed to the top of the standings with a perfect start to their round-robin campaign.
Juventus scraped into the semifinals of the Coppa Italia with a 2-1 victory over Sassuolo and will face Fiorentina after they also struck late on to beat Atalanta 3-2 on Thursday. Juventus took the lead in the third minute when Paulo Dybala bounced home a volley. Sassuolo hit back in the 23rd minute with Hamed Traore bending a superb effort past keeper Mattia Perin. Both sides had chances in the second half but Juventus grabbed the winner in the 88th minute when Dusan Vlahovic wriggled through on the left and his shot deflected in off the arm of Ruan Tressoldi.
Team GB suffered their first defeat in the men’s curling when losing a topsy-turvy encounter to Team USA. Hammy McMillan, Bobby Lammie, Grant Hardie and skip Bruce Mouat beat Italy in their Olympic Games opener. Jurgen Klopp savoured Diogo Jota's «genius» contribution to his side's comfortable 2-0 Premier League win over Leicester City. The Reds boss named a much-changed lineup from the previous weekend's FA Cup tie with Cardiff City, bringing in regulars Alisson, Joel Matip, Andrew Robertson, Fabinho and Thiago with Luis Diaz also given his first start for the club after his cameo against the Bluebirds.
